Mulan – The Parade

Mulan – The Parade was a daytime procession presented at Disney-MGM Studios during the late 1990s and early 2000s. Debuting on June 19, 1998, the same day Disney’s animated Mulan opened in U.S. theaters, the parade continued the park’s tradition of quickly transforming new animated releases into full-scale street entertainment. Rainforest Café Restaurant

Rainforest Café at Disney’s Animal Kingdom is a themed table-service restaurant located just outside the park’s main entrance, making it unusual among Walt Disney World restaurants because it can be accessed from both inside and outside the park.
